@jonnyotbc72482 жыл бұрын
Nice man. I just got a Speed triple rs. On first ride, i was in sport mode, had traction control on, and (without going into too much detail why) i opened her up big in first gear and unintentionally and unexpectedly pulled a wheelie - my first one ever. I thought when TC is on then by default so is wheelie control: do you know why this would've happened? Have you encountered same thing? I wonder if it's a fault, i've not got settings right, or if it's just wheelie control doesn't necessarily mean you won't wheelie at all, especially when suddenly revving up in first gear?
@sergeantsodom69692 жыл бұрын
Not a fault at all mate, you've bought yourself a very powerful bike, not sure what you expect especially in first gear, its something a lot of 600+ CC bikes will do. One of my main buying-points when I look at a bike, is will it wheelie- its fun. Standard TC does not determine if the bike will wheelie- just the rear wheel spinning faster or slower than the front and reduces power accordinly. That being said, this bikes Bosch ECU combines Anti-wheelie and TC (Dont ask why, stupid idea)- however this is the best wheelie control i've ever ridden with. Long story short, yes its totally normal and they'd probably laugh if you took it back to the dealer claiming a fault
